One of the most painful and heartbreaking things in the world is suicide. When someone close to you decides to end their life, it takes a toll on everyone in the family, but it's especially hard on the kids left behind. As a parent, it's critical that you understand the warning signs of suicide so you can save your child before they make the decision to end their life. Here are some signs of suicide you shouldn't ignore as indicated by the best psychiatrist in Bhopal:

Unexplained sudden change in behavior or appearance

You might be able to spot a change in your loved one’s mood or behavior—especially if they have a known mental health condition. But changes in appearance and routine can also be a sign that something is off. If your loved one stops going to school, social gatherings, or work; has lost interest in hobbies or sports; has changed their diet; or seems anxious and paranoid, get help right away.

Isolation from family and friends

People who are struggling with suicidal thoughts often withdraw from others, instead preferring to spend time alone. When they do speak to loved ones, it’s common for them to focus on sharing pessimistic views of their future. If you notice a loved one pulling away or constantly talking about how hopeless their situation is, pay attention—these are two major red flags that could indicate suicidal thoughts.

Self-destructive behavior

A person who is considering or planning suicide might behave in a self-destructive manner, such as engaging in reckless behavior that threatens his health and safety. If you notice someone exhibiting increasingly risky behaviors, such as excessive drinking or driving too fast, speak up—ask if he's thinking about killing himself, says the best psychiatrist in Bhopal.
